Reframe: How to Stop Listening to Fear and Start Leading from Within

Rate this book
How to Stop Listening to Fear and Start Leading from Within

You’ve worked hard, you care deeply, and you want to make a difference—but fear still “Are you sure you belong here?”

If you’ve ever wrestled with self-doubt, perfectionism, people-pleasing, or the fear of being “found out,” Reframe is the permission slip you didn’t know you needed.

In this deeply compassionate and actionable guide, leadership and career coach, Michael Goodman, shares real stories, practical tools, and transformative insights from years of helping high-performing professionals quiet fear and step into the power of authentic leadership.

This book isn’t about hustle, fixing yourself, or pretending you’re fearless. It’s about reconnecting with who you are beneath the noise—so you can lead, live, and grow with courage and clarity.

Inside Reframe, you’ll discover how

Name, normalize, and neutralize fear so it no longer drives your choices.

Redefine success on your own terms—no more chasing someone else’s version of achievement.

Shift from “Why me?” to “What now?” and unlock growth in moments of uncertainty.

Build unshakable self-trust that grounds you through change, challenge, and ambition.

Lead from wherever you are—with or without a title.

Through a blend of coaching wisdom, personal reflections, and tools you can use today, Reframe offers a new lens on fear—and a new path forward.

You don’t need to become someone else to lead.
You just need to stop abandoning yourself.
